Major Cause of Death


Malaria was a major cause of death in Mali with 28794 registered deaths (in year 2016) i.e. 20% of total deaths. Overall Malaria, Neonatal deaths and Diarrheal diseases were the highest types of death causes in Mali.
    Major Cause of Death in Mali
  • We see the maximum number of deaths is seen in age group Under-5 with 84212 deaths (year 2016).
  • 28.53% kids below age 5 years die because of Malaria.
  • Malaria, Diarrheal diseases and Nutritional deficiencies are the major cause of death in kids aged 5 - 14 years.
  • HIV/AIDS, Cancers and Cardiovascular disease are the major cause of death in people aged 14 - 49 years.
  • Cardiovascular diseases, Cancers and Diarrheal diseases are the major cause of death in people aged over 50 years.
  • Overall, it's observed that 26% of people aging over 50 years die because of Cardiovascular diseases.

Major Risk Factors of Death


  • Three Major factors of death in Mali are Child wasting, Unsafe water source and Poor sanitation. Every year around 13550 people die due to Child wasting.
  • Child wasting and Low birth weight are the major risk factor of kids death aging under 5 years.
  • Unsafe water source and Poor sanitation are the major risk factors of death of people aging between 5 to 14 years.
  • Unsafe sex, Unsafe water source and Poor sanitation are the death risk factors of people aging between 15 to 49 years.
  • High blood pressure, Household air pollution and High body-mass index (obesity) are the major death risk factors of people aging between 50 to 69 years.
  • High blood pressure is the major death risk factors for people aging more than 70 years.

Cancer Analysis


0.19% of Mali population was suffering from cancer i.e. 13576 people (average of years 2011-2016). Highest number of cancer patients deaths were recorded due to Liver cancer (Count : 1568) and Stomach cancer was also concerning with 996 deaths in a year. In last few years it has been observed that, people suffering from Esophageal cancer have 1% of survival chance.Mali was really successful in diagnosing Kidney cancer where 89% of people were cured.Highest number of cancer patients i.e. 5695 people were of age group 50-69 year olds.In 2016, 2493 were suffering from Liver cancer out of which 1568 people were dead. This means 62.9% death rate of people suffering from Liver cancer. This below data represents major cancer types in Mali and number of deaths due to particular cancer types :
